Фундамент HTML и CSS для стартующих

Построение веб-страниц стартует с освоения двух базовых технологий. HTML отвечает за структуру и содержимое страниц. CSS контролирует визуальным дизайном блоков.

Специалисты используют HTML для расположения текста, картинок, линков и других компонентов. CSS позволяет задавать цвета, гарнитуры, размеры и позиционирование блоков. Эти языки функционируют вместе и дополняются друг друга.

Овладение 7k casino открывает путь к профессии веб-разработчика. Владение базовых правил способствует разрабатывать действующие и привлекательные сайты. Начинающие специалисты могут быстро приобрести прикладные умения и использовать их в живых задачах.

Что такое HTML и зачем он необходим сайту

HTML интерпретируется как HyperText Markup Language. Язык разметки задаёт организацию веб-документов и упорядочивает содержимое страниц. Браузеры интерпретируют HTML-код и выводят данные в доступном для пользователей виде.

Каждый компонент страницы задаётся специальными директивами. Названия, абзацы, перечни, таблицы и формы создаются с посредством меток. Метки представляют собой команды, заключённые в угловые скобки. Браузер читает эти директивы и генерирует графическое представление содержимого.

Без HTML невозможно разработать 7К казино любого типа. Язык разметки выступает фундаментом для всех сайтов. Поисковые системы анализируют HTML-структуру для каталогизации веб-страниц. Правильная структура повышает позиции портала в результатах поиска.

HTML регулярно совершенствуется и обретает свежие опции. Актуальная версия HTML5 обеспечивает видео, аудио и интерактивные компоненты. Специалисты могут встраивать медийный контент без внешних модулей. Семантические элементы позволяют казино 7к лучше осознавать функцию разных секций веб-страницы.

Ключевые метки и архитектура веб-страницы

Любой HTML-документ имеет определённую иерархическую архитектуру. Главный блок html включает всё содержимое веб-страницы. Внутри располагаются два главных блока: head и body.

Секция head сохраняет техническую информацию о документе. Здесь прописывается титул веб-страницы, добавляются стили и скрипты. Пользователи не видят наполнение этого блока прямо. Секция body включает весь доступный контент.

Для упорядочивания контента используются разные элементы:

  • h1-h6 формируют заголовки разных степеней
  • p создаёт текстовые параграфы
  • a создаёт линки на прочие страницы
  • img встраивает изображения в документ
  • ul и ol создают маркерные и нумерованные списки
  • table упорядочивает данные в табличном формате

Семантические элементы превращают структуру более понятной. Тег header маркирует верхнюю часть сайта. Метка nav группирует навигационные ссылки. Контейнер main включает центральное содержимое веб-страницы. Footer находится в подвальной области и содержит контактную информацию.

Корректная структура страницы значима для доступности. Программы чтения с экрана применяют 7k casino для навигации по сайту. Логическая структура блоков упрощает понимание контента всеми группами зрителей. Правильный программа функционирует исправно во всех современных браузерах.

Как CSS отвечает за внешний вид портала

CSS расшифровывается как Cascading Style Sheets. Каскадные таблицы стилей устанавливают зрительное представление HTML-элементов. Технология разделяет оформление от структуры страницы.

Без стилей все веб-страницы выглядят единообразно. Браузер выводит текст чёрным цветом на белом фоне. Заголовки приобретают типовые габариты. CSS даёт возможность поменять каждый аспект внешнего вида.

Стили можно подключить тремя методами. Внешний файл соединяется с HTML-документом через метку link. Внутренние стили размещаются в теге style. Инлайновые стили указываются в свойстве элемента.

Каскадность обозначает приоритет применения инструкций. Встроенные стили имеют наивысший вес. Внутренние стили перекрывают отдельные. Браузер использует наиболее специфичное директиву к каждому компоненту.

CSS регулирует всеми визуальными характеристиками. Программисты устанавливают оттенки подложки и текста. Стили корректируют размеры, поля и обводки контейнеров. Актуальный 7К казино задействует анимации и переходы для формирования интерактивных результатов.

Селекторы, атрибуты и значения в CSS

Директива CSS складывается из трёх компонентов. Селектор обозначает элемент для стилизации. Свойство задаёт особенность стилизации. Параметр задаёт точный значение.

Селекторы отбирают компоненты по различным критериям. Селектор элемента использует стили ко всем тегам определённого типа. Селектор класса работает с атрибутом class. Селектор идентификатора выбирает уникальный компонент по атрибуту id.

Составные селекторы генерируют более конкретные директивы. Селектор потомка выбирает внутренние элементы. Селектор непосредственного тега работает только с прямыми детьми. Псевдоклассы назначают стили при заданных состояниях.

Свойства определяют различные аспекты дизайна. Параметры color и background-color управляют цветовой схемой. Параметры width и height определяют размеры. Свойства margin и padding регулируют поля.

Значения прописываются в разных видах. Цвета указываются в шестнадцатеричном формате, RGB или именами. Величины измеряются в пикселях, процентах или пропорциональных единицах. Правильное задействование селекторов способствует казино 7к результативно регулировать дизайном множества элементов.

Управление с тонами, шрифтами и полями

Цветовое стилизация формирует графическую настроение веб-страницы. Параметр color меняет оттенок текста. Свойство background-color устанавливает задний план блока. Тона записываются несколькими вариантами: названиями, шестнадцатеричными записями или значениями RGB.

Шестнадцатеричный формат начинается с знака диеза. Запись формируется из шести элементов, определяющих красный, зелёный и синий составляющие. Тип RGB задействует цифровые величины от 0 до 255 для каждого компонента. Тип RGBA включает свойство непрозрачности.

Шрифтовое оформление влияет на читаемость материала. Атрибут font-family определяет тип шрифта. Параметр font-size определяет размер символов. Атрибут font-weight управляет толщину начертания. Параметр line-height определяет межстрочный интервал.

Системные шрифты имеются на всех устройствах. Веб-шрифты загружаются с сторонних серверов. Платформа Google Fonts даёт свободную коллекцию гарнитур. Специалисты задают несколько шрифтов в очерёдности предпочтения.

Интервалы генерируют область вокруг элементов. Атрибут margin генерирует наружные поля между контейнерами. Атрибут padding формирует внутренние интервалы от границ до наполнения. Интервалы можно определять для каждой грани отдельно или одним параметром единовременно для всех краёв. Грамотное использование 7k casino усиливает графическую организацию и понимание контента.

Блочная концепция и позиционирование блоков

Блочная концепция определяет организацию каждого HTML-элемента. Модель формируется из четырёх областей: содержимого, внутреннего поля, обводки и внешнего интервала. Знание этой концепции требуется для точного управления размерами.

Зона контента включает текст и иллюстрации. Внутренний отступ padding формирует пространство между контентом и краем. Обводка border окружает элемент заметной линией. Внешний поле margin формирует промежуток до прилегающих блоков.

Свойство box-sizing изменяет вычисление размеров. Значение content-box включает только контент. Вариант border-box добавляет padding и border в общую размер.

Свойство display устанавливает вид отображения. Блочные компоненты используют всю имеющуюся ширину. Строчные элементы размещаются в одной ряду. Параметр inline-block сочетает свойства обоих видов.

Атрибут position регулирует расположением. Параметр relative перемещает блок относительно исходного места. Absolute размещает блок относительно вышестоящего блока. Современный 7К казино применяет Flexbox и Grid для формирования многоуровневых структур.

Гибкая разработка для разнообразных платформ

Отзывчивая вёрстка предоставляет верное отображение сайта на всех мониторах. Пользователи заходят на веб-страницы с ПК, планшетных устройств и телефонов. Оформление обязан подстраиваться под размер монитора самостоятельно.

Медиазапросы применяют стили в связи от параметров платформы. Правило @media проверяет ширину экрана и другие свойства. Специалисты генерируют индивидуальные коллекции стилей для разных промежутков размеров.

Принцип mobile-first открывает разработку с версии для мобильных устройств. Начальные стили задают оформление для маленьких мониторов. Медиазапросы добавляют расширения для широких экранов.

Адаптивные макеты задействуют относительные величины измерения. Ширина блоков задаётся в процентах вместо фиксированных точек. Flexbox и Grid генерируют отзывчивые компоновки без комплексных вычислений.

Картинки требуют особого подхода при адаптации. Свойство max-width со величиной 100% исключает вылет иллюстраций за пределы блока. Атрибут srcset скачивает иллюстрации разнообразного разрешения. Грамотная внедрение 7k casino улучшает пользовательский впечатление на всех типах аппаратов.

Типичные ошибки новичков при взаимодействии с HTML и CSS

Начинающие разработчики делают типичные промахи при создании веб-страниц. Понимание распространённых проблем способствует избежать их в своих проектах. Коррекция недочётов на начальных фазах экономит время и усиливает качество программы.

Главные промахи при разработке с структурой и стилями:

  • Открытые элементы ломают архитектуру файла и приводят к некорректному представлению
  • Применение deprecated тегов вместо новых семантических элементов
  • Недостаток альтернативного текста для картинок уменьшает доступность содержимого
  • Inline стили в HTML осложняют обслуживание и изменение стилизации
  • Некорректная иерархия элементов создаёт проблемы в структуре
  • Чрезмерное задействование идентификаторов вместо классов ограничивает многократное использование стилей

Недочёты с CSS также встречаются часто. Стартующие упускают указывать меры расчёта для цифровых параметров. Излишне специфичные селекторы усложняют изменение стилей. Отсутствие обнуления стилей браузера порождает различия в визуализации на различных платформах.

Игнорирование кроссбраузерной согласованности ведёт к проблемам. Сайт может отлично смотреться в одном обозревателе и некорректно в втором. Верификация программы посредством специальные сервисы находит синтаксические ошибки. Регулярная проверка способствует казино 7к обеспечивать высокое качество разработки и согласованность стандартам.